
Cleveland mayor's grandson shot to death
CBSN
The grandson of Cleveland Mayor Frank Jackson was shot and killed Sunday night, police said. No suspects were in custody.
CBS Cleveland affiliate WOIO-TV reported that the grandson, Frank Q. Jackson, 24, was shot near an intersection at about 9:10 p.m.
Shortly before the shooting, a third party had dropped him off nearby, a law enforcement source familiar with the case told WOIO. Then someone ran up to him and shot him multiple times, the source said.
